Master 23 can be equipped with an optional C axis thus increasing the flexibility of these work centres

Worktable

The machine’s base is made up of an extremely rigid structure upon which is placed an aluminium worktable rectified to grant maximum flatness of the work area. This is an indispensable condition to get a perfect processing result

  • Master 23 | Work centres | Intermac | Glass Division

Tool change (opt.)

18 position tool change on the back side of the machine with tool automatic charger through the operating unit

Machine control and software

Master 23 is equipped with the IWNC numerical control integrated into a personal computer with a Windows interface. The advantages of this solution are evident and introduce a new standard in the design of this type of machine. The use of a PC with Windows XP operating system is extremely simple and intuitive for the operator and provides full connectivity with commercially available network systems and optical/magnetic supports. The PC is supplied complete with CD-ROM drive, modem and network card, 15” colour monitor and Windows XP operating system. The PC modem and teleservice software enables remote diagnostics and software. It's possible to connect a webcam to the PC, to save and transmit in real time to the service department, instant images of some details of the machine
